Final answer:
The compound inequality x - 7 < -9 or x - 7 > 9 is equivalent to the absolute value inequality |x - 7| > 9.
Step-by-step explanation:
The compound inequality given is x − 7 < − 9 or x − 7 > 9. To rewrite this compound inequality as an absolute value inequality, we recognize that we're dealing with distances from the point 7 on the number line. We want to find when x is either more than 9 units to the right or more than 9 units to the left of 7. This is equivalent to saying that the absolute value of x − 7 is greater than 9. So, the absolute value inequality is |x − 7| > 9.
